Oklahoma Statutes

Okla. Stat. tit. 17, § 158.31 (2026)

Liberal construction

This act shall be construed liberally. The enumeration of any object, purpose, power, manner, method or thing shall not be deemed to exclude like or similar objects, purposes, powers, manners, methods or things. Laws 1971, c. 113, § 11.
